Definition & Meaning

The Business Certificate Form X201 is a document used primarily in business registration processes. In the United States, this form serves as an official record certifying the business's operation under an assumed name, often referred to as a "doing business as" (DBA) name. It provides legitimacy to the business name in transactions and legal proceedings, allowing businesses to operate without using the owner's legal name. Such a certificate is crucial for sole proprietors, partnerships, LLCs, and corporations aiming to conduct business under a name different than their registered name.

Steps to Complete the Business Certificate Form X201

  1. Gather Required Information:

    • Owner’s legal name and contact information.
    • Desired business name (DBA).
    • Physical and mailing addresses of the business.
  2. Fill Out the Form:

    • Provide accurate details in each section.
    • Ensure all fields are completed as necessary to avoid rejection.
  3. Signature and Notarization:

    • Some jurisdictions may require the form to be notarized to confirm authenticity.
  4. Submission:

    • Submit to the appropriate local or state agency either online, by mail, or in person.
    • Retain a copy for personal records.

State-Specific Rules for the Business Certificate Form X201

Different states impose their respective requirements for filing the Business Certificate Form X201. Regulations can vary greatly, affecting elements such as filing fees, notarization requirements, and processing times. For instance:

  • In California, the filing might include publishing a notice in a local newspaper.
  • In New York, DBA filings are usually processed at the county level. Understanding these variances is crucial to ensuring proper and legal filing of the form, preventing any operational delays or legal complications associated with improper filing.

Legal Use of the Business Certificate Form X201

Legally, the Business Certificate Form X201 is used to prevent the misuse of business names and ensures that the public can identify the true owners of a business. It serves as a protective measure for consumers, allowing them to trace the entity behind a business name. For many businesses, properly filing this form can also prevent legal disputes over business names and is often a prerequisite for opening business bank accounts under the DBA.

Key Elements of the Business Certificate Form X201

  • Owner Information: The legal name, addresses, and contact details of the business owner or responsible individual.
  • Business Name Details: The exact DBA name for which the certificate is sought.
  • Operational Addresses: Both the business’s physical and mailing addresses if they differ.
  • Signature Section: Required to validate the intentions of filing the name under the appropriate person/entity.
  • State/County Specific Requirements: May include notarization or additional attachments as regulated locally.
